They come with a Bluetooth audio transmitter, so you can plug them into anything that has a headphone plug on them. This also has the bonus of by-passing the Bluetooth stack issue on the Axims. You can also use them off a standard bluetooth device that has the right stack, but my laptop doesn't currently have a bluetooth card in it, so I'd need to use a dongle anyway. Sound is good quality, although I'm not an audio-phile by any means. Range is good, at least 20 feet. People in the office look at me funny when I walk over to the printer still wearing my headphones.

Battery life hasn't been an issue at all; I plug them in at night, and they last me all day.
All in all, I'm a happy camper with them. I wish they were cheaper, but I got a good price on them, I think. Don't tell my wife, though.

I'll never go back to corded phones. It's just too convenient not having cords to either pull your headphones off your desk, or strangle you when you get up and forget about them.
